Introduction: The Deep Connection Between Meitetsu Kasamatsu Station and the Anime “Uma Musume Cinderella Grey”
The anime “Uma Musume Cinderella Grey” began broadcasting in April 2025. The model for the “Kasamatsu Station” that serves as the setting for the story is Meitetsu Kasamatsu Station located in Kasamatsu Town, Hashima District, Gifu Prefecture. Known as the nearest station to Kasamatsu Racecourse, which produced the famous racehorse Oguri Cap during its active years from 1987 to 1990, this station has become a sacred site with many fans visiting due to large-scale collaboration projects implemented in conjunction with the anime’s broadcast start.

Anime “Uma Musume Cinderella Grey” Overview
“Uma Musume Cinderella Grey” is an anime adaptation of a manga work by Yoshiharu Kusumi serialized in Weekly Young Jump published by Shueisha Corporation. It was produced as part of the “Uma Musume Pretty Derby” project developed by Cygames Corporation and began broadcasting in April 2025.
The story’s protagonist is an Uma Musume named Oguri Cap from a local racecourse. A coming-of-age story is depicted where she aims for the top of central horse racing starting from “Kasamatsu Racecourse,” modeled after Kasamatsu Racecourse. It is motif-based on the trajectory of the actual racehorse Oguri Cap, with Kasamatsu Town serving as an important stage in the anime, which is a major characteristic.
Many actual landscapes of Kasamatsu Town appear in the anime, including Meitetsu Kasamatsu Station. The scenes depicted as “Kasamatsu Station” in the work hold special significance for fans.
Basic Information and Access to Meitetsu Kasamatsu Station
Station Overview
Meitetsu Kasamatsu Station is a station on the Meitetsu Takehana Line. Its address is 1 Nishikanaikecho, Kasamatsu Town, Hashima District, Gifu Prefecture. It is conveniently located just about a 3-minute walk from Kasamatsu Racecourse, and many racing fans use this station on race days.
Access Methods
From Nagoya area:
- Express train from Meitetsu Nagoya Station to Meitetsu Gifu Station takes about 30 minutes
- Transfer to the Takehana Line at Meitetsu Gifu Station, about 10 minutes to Kasamatsu Station
- Total travel time: approximately 40–50 minutes
From within Gifu City:
- About 10 minutes on the Takehana Line from Meitetsu Gifu Station (Shin-Gifu Station)

The Full Picture of Kasamatsu Town × “Uma Musume Cinderella Grey” Collaboration Project
Since April 26, 2025 (Saturday), Kasamatsu Town has been implementing a collaboration project with the anime “Uma Musume Cinderella Grey” in cooperation with Shueisha Corporation and Cygames Corporation. This collaboration project is being developed as a large-scale project with full town participation under the full cooperation of the Cinderella Grey Production Committee.

Collaboration Project ③: Life-Size Panel Photo Spot
Life-size anime character panels are displayed at “Furat Kasamatsu,” an information and exchange facility inside Meitetsu Kasamatsu Station.
Display details:
- Display location: “Furat Kasamatsu” inside Meitetsu Kasamatsu Station
- Display period: Until March 31, 2026 (Tuesday) (scheduled)
- Business hours: From first train to last train
- Photography: Free (please be considerate of other users)
※The display end date may be subject to change. Please confirm the latest information at the Kasamatsu Town official website or “Furat Kasamatsu.”
The life-size panel has become an excellent photo spot, with many fans enjoying commemorative photos. Crowding is expected especially on weekends and holidays, so a visit with plenty of time is recommended.
Collaboration Project ④: “Uma Musume Cinderella Grey” Decorations Throughout Kasamatsu Town
Decorations for the anime “Uma Musume Cinderella Grey” are being displayed not only at Meitetsu Kasamatsu Station but throughout various locations in Kasamatsu Town.
Main decoration content:
- Station nameplate decoration in Uma Musume style (“Kasamatsu Station” notation)
- Meitetsu Kasamatsu Station collaboration signage
- Poster displays at major facilities throughout town
- Special decoration around Kasamatsu Racecourse
The fact that the station nameplate is actually decorated with “Kasamatsu Station” notation like in the anime is an emotional presentation for fans. It was implemented for a limited period from April 13 to June 30, 2025, and the decoration continues in different forms afterward.

Nearby Tourist Attractions
There are attractive tourist destinations other than collaboration projects in the area around Meitetsu Kasamatsu Station.
Kasamatsu Racecourse
Just a 3-minute walk from the station, Kasamatsu Racecourse is a historic racing venue that produced Oguri Cap. With an atmosphere unique to local horse racing, it can be enjoyed even by those unfamiliar with racing.
Scenery Along the Kiso River
Kasamatsu Town faces the Kiso River, and the view from the riverbed is spectacular. A walk is recommended on sunny days.
Access to Gifu City
Taking advantage of its convenient location just about 10 minutes from Meitetsu Gifu Station, combining this with tourist destinations in Gifu City such as Gifu Castle and Kawarabara is also popular.
